Aquaregia is a mixture of 

A

`HCl +CH_(3)COOH`

B

`3HNO_3+HCl`

C

`H_(3)PO_(4)+H_(2)SO_(4)`

D

`3HCl + HNO_3`

Text Solution

Verified by Experts

The correct Answer is:
D

Aqua-regia : 3 moles of con. HCI + 1 mol of con. HNO,
